Today I am sharing my recipe for a pumpkin pie Nutrisystem protein Drink. You can watch me make it in this video. I start with a Nutrisystem Vanilla Protein Drink mix add, water and ice per the packet instructions. Then I add a ½ cup of pumpkin puree and pie spices to taste…I like nutmeg and cinnamon. Blend your ingredients until smooth, serve and enjoy. This counts as a protein and a smart carb.
